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: (1) Aged 1-14 years old, diarrhea more than 3 times a day, laboratory test, CD positive; (2) Recurrent CDI (recurrence more than 3 times); (3) Refractory CDI (conventional vancomycin or other anti CD drugs for 6-8 weeks without curative effect); (4) Legal guardian fully understands and signs informed consent.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: (1) Subjects combined with other serious diseases of digestive tract; (2) Subjects combined with other serious diseases of the system.
